Continue ReadingEarlier this week, we took a look at some of the top athletes that the Class of 2024 has in its ranks. Today, that process continues with four more elite athletes.
Wade Jones Wade Jones 6'5" | 200 lbs | ATH Tippecanoe Valley | 2024 State IN , 6’5, 185 pounds, Tippecanoe
Wade Jones Wade Jones 6'5" | 200 lbs | ATH Tippecanoe Valley | 2024 State IN excels on both sides of the ball, playing free safety as well as super back. At his free safety position, he reads the eyes of the quarterback like a book. He sees where the quarterback is going and jumps in front. Jones is a ball hawk on the back end, and he can make something happen when he does get the ball. Jones is terrific at making tacklers miss on interception returns, setting the offense up in even better field position. Jones is not afraid to play the run, either. He can come down and make a good form tackle. On offense, Jones can be a solid receiving option. Last year, he caught half-a-dozen passes for 85 yards and one touchdown. He handles punting duties for Tippecanoe, as well. Jones punted 26 times for a net total of 724 yards with eight punts inside the 20-yard line.
Matt Koontz Matt Koontz 6'1" | 180 lbs | ATH Hanover Central | 2024 State IN , Hanover Central
Matt Koontz Matt Koontz 6'1" | 180 lbs | ATH Hanover Central | 2024 State IN is a playmaker at quarterback for Hanover Central. The southpaw demonstrates the ability to read the defense and make good decisions. He runs the run-pass-option and the read option with precision. Koontz can scan the field and get the offense into the best play for that situation. Koontz has the ability to use his legs effectively. He can break the pocket and elude tacklers to pick up positive yards. Last season, Koontz threw 24 touchdowns and just seven interceptions with a total of 1,821 passing yards.
Gabe McGuire Gabe McGuire 5'10" | 175 lbs | ATH Alexandria-Monroe | 2024 State IN , 5’10, 160 pounds, Alexandria-Monroe
Gabe McGuire Gabe McGuire 5'10" | 175 lbs | ATH Alexandria-Monroe | 2024 State IN is Alexandria-Monroe’s sparkplug in all three phases. On offense, McGuire can hurt teams with his feet and his hands. In 2021, he carried 18 times for 171 yards and a pair of touchdowns. Through the air he was a go-to receiver, totaling 40 receptions for 481 yards and six touchdowns. Defensively, McGuire recorded 33 tackles, one interception, two passes defensed and one fumble recovery. On special teams, he served as the team’s punter. He punted 36 times for 1,189 net punting yards with three punts inside the 20. He also showed that he can contribute as a returner, as well, notching 73 kickoff return and 89 punt return yards.
Dontrez Fuller Dontrez Fuller 5'10" | 155 lbs | ATH Anderson | 2024 State IN , 5’10, 155 pounds, Anderson
Dontrez Fuller Dontrez Fuller 5'10" | 155 lbs | ATH Anderson | 2024 State IN is an elite, multipurpose prospect. He has the ability to play wide receiver, strong safety and cornerback. At corner, Fuller displays impeccable timing. Fuller has good tackling skills. He can spot the ball and break on it at just the right time to break up the pass. At wide receiver, Fuller has the speed to take the top off the defense, but when working the underneath and intermediate routes, he can create separation. Look for Dontrez Fuller Dontrez Fuller 5'10" | 155 lbs | ATH Anderson | 2024 State IN to have a big junior season.
